Practical Crafter Notes for Success

To get the most out of this graphic design asset, follow these practical steps from my own workflow:

  1. Test Before Selling: Never skip the proofing stage. Print a sample, apply it to a scrap material, and check for alignment issues or color shifts. This saves money and reputation.
  2. Check File Integrity: Open the SVG design in your cutting software to ensure all paths are closed and there are no stray nodes. Clean files prevent cutting errors and wasted material.
  3. Preview Transparency: If using the PNG design, verify the transparency background. Ensure there are no unwanted white boxes around the edges that could ruin the final look.
  4. Confirm Resolution: For sublimation design, high resolution is non-negotiable. Check the DPI to ensure crisp prints without pixelation, especially when enlarging for larger products.
  5. Font Pairing: Experiment with typography. This illustration pairs well with serif fonts for a classic look, sans serif fonts for modern clarity, or handwritten fonts for a personal touch. Avoid cluttering the design with too many typefaces.
  6. Verify Commercial License: Before using this for customer orders or handmade business products, confirm the commercial license terms. Understanding what you can and cannot do protects your small business from legal issues.
